Why is Communication Important in Business?

Effective communication is a cornerstone of any successful business. It is essential for building relationships, fostering collaboration, and ensuring that everyone is on the same page. Communication within a business can take many forms, including verbal, written, and non-verbal, and it plays a crucial role in the day-to-day operations of a company.

Why is communication important in business? Communication is important in business because it facilitates the exchange of information, helps in decision-making, and enhances productivity. Clear communication ensures that all team members understand their roles and responsibilities, which leads to better coordination and efficiency. It also helps in resolving conflicts and building a positive work environment.

Enhancing Team Collaboration

One of the primary benefits of effective communication in business is enhanced team collaboration. When team members communicate openly and honestly, they are more likely to share ideas, provide feedback, and work together towards common goals. This collaborative environment fosters innovation and creativity, as employees feel valued and heard.

Moreover, clear communication helps in setting expectations and aligning team efforts. When everyone understands the objectives and the steps needed to achieve them, it reduces misunderstandings and ensures that the team is working in harmony. This collaborative approach not only improves productivity but also boosts morale and job satisfaction among employees.

Improving Customer Relations

Effective communication is also vital for maintaining strong customer relations. Businesses that communicate clearly and consistently with their customers are more likely to build trust and loyalty. This involves not only providing accurate information about products and services but also addressing customer concerns and feedback promptly.

Good communication with customers can lead to repeat business and positive word-of-mouth referrals. It helps in understanding customer needs and preferences, allowing businesses to tailor their offerings accordingly. In turn, this can lead to increased customer satisfaction and long-term success for the company.

In summary, communication is a critical component of business operations. It enhances team collaboration, improves customer relations, and ensures that everyone is aligned with the company’s goals. By prioritizing effective communication, businesses can create a more productive and positive work environment, ultimately leading to greater success.
